Web"outworker" means a person engaged, in or about a private residence or other premises that are not necessarily business or commercial premises, to perform clothing work; S. 3 def. of payment of wages provisions inserted by No. 24/2009 s. 19(2). "payment of wages provisions "means Division 2 of Part 2-9 of the Commonwealth Fair Work Act;

Web“outworker” means a person to whom articles or materials are given out to be made up, cleaned, washed, altered, ornamented, finished, repaired or adapted for sale in the person’s own home or on other premises not under the control or management of the person who gave out the articles or materials; (“travailleur indépendant”) WebIn its view, an outworker and an independent contractor within the meaning of s.3(6) fell within mutually exclusive categories. The reasoning was that an independent contractor within s.3(6), having been deemed to be employed under a contract of service and to that extent brought within the definition of "Worker", could not be excluded by the exclusion of …
